Is Software Testing A Good Career Choice?

Introduction:
The creation of high-quality
software products depends heavily on software testing. It is a crucial phase in
the software development process that ensures the programs are of high quality
and meet the needs of the consumers. The rapid advancement of technology,
particularly the introduction of artificial intelligence (AI) and machine
learning (ML), makes the future of software testing exciting. The need for
competent software testers is growing as technology develops. However, before
advancing into the world of software testing, a brief Software
Testing Course holds great importance. Being a software tester, you
need to have a minute look at the software to analyze it from different
parameters. A good testing course helps you develop all these necessary skills.
Because the skills you develop will be really helpful in the journey of
software testing. Moreover, with the growing demand for software testers, it
makes it a lucrative career choice.
Compelling Reasons to Consider a Career as Software
Tester:
Growing Demand: As the software business expands, there is a rising
demand for software testers. To ensure the goods satisfy quality requirements,
businesses need to hire qualified specialists when they create new
applications, websites, and software programs. This actually becomes the
primary reason for the growing demand for software testers in the industry.
Because a developer can not test the application like a professional tester.
However, when someone else does the testing, there are more chances of
identification of errors and bugs.
Career Stability: Software testing has a very stable future. There
will continually be a demand for testers as long as there is software development.
And further, new technologies come into existence. This stability actually
offers a sense of security and chances for professional advancement.
Diverse Opportunities: There are several opportunities available in
software testing. Functional, performance, security, and test automation
testing are some of the specializations available to testers. Thus, due to the
diversity, people can explore their hobbies and gain skills in particular
fields.
Collaboration: Working closely with different stakeholders, such as
developers, project managers, and designers, is necessary while testing
software. Testers serve as a link between several teams, building successful
teamwork, problem-solving, and communication. Personal and professional
development is indeed necessary in this collaborative setting.
Continuous Learning: New tools, processes, and techniques are
frequently released, and the area of software testing is always growing.
Therefore, to provide effective testing solutions, testers must stay current on
the newest trends and technology. This element of lifelong learning keeps the
work exciting and difficult.
Quality Assurance: Software testers are in charge of guaranteeing
the accuracy and dependability of software products. They are indeed vital in
enhancing the overall user experience by locating and reporting faults. Testers
have the chance to promote quality; which certainly has a big impact on how
successful software projects are.
Problem-Solving: Testing involves reviewing intricate systems,
spotting potential problems, and coming up with solutions. Testers are adept
problem solvers who use analytical and critical thinking to find and fix
software bugs. This element of the profession further stimulates the mind and
encourages creativity.
Competitive Salary: Because of the high demand for qualified
software testers, there are now competitive wages and alluring benefits
available. Companies are willing to invest in their skills. Now they understand
the importance of skilled testers to ensure the excellence of their products.
Versatility: Software testing expertise is applicable in a variety
of fields. Testers can find employment in a range of industries, including
e-commerce, gaming, healthcare, and finance. This adaptability creates chances
to work on various projects and additionally earn useful experience.
Continuous Demand: The software development life cycle includes
software testing as a necessary step. The software requires careful testing,
whether it's a new product or continuing updates. Software testers also have
the assurance of a consistent flow of work thanks to this ongoing need.
Conclusion:
Post Your Ad Here
Comments